MEMO — To all branch managers, Pellwright Hardware
Quick heads-up: the Q3 cash-flow forecast from Dana in finance looks tighter than usual, mainly due to the Ashgrove refit. Expect slower approvals on discretionary spend through September. Receivables are otherwise healthy. Full figures at Thursday's call. The confidential note on our plans sits just below.

internal memo for bahap-yagug: Headcount on the Ulaix team goes from 3 to 100 by the end of January. Gross margin on Ulaix came in at 10 percent against a plan of 15 percent.

## Changelog — Fernwick Uploader v2.4

The setting `CHARSET_SNIFF_MODE` has been renamed to `ENCODING_DETECT_STRATEGY` to better reflect what it does: choosing between byte-order-mark inspection and statistical detection for uploaded text files. The old name still works but logs a deprecation warning, and it will be removed in v3.0. New team members should update any local env files they copied from older docs. Detection also now requires an API token for the Lintholm charset service, so add the following line to your env file:

env line for fafof-fahag: LEDGER_TOKEN5=f8790

Hey, welcome to the Podlark team! As release manager, you own Feedcheck, our podcast feed validator. Every release candidate has to pass a full Feedcheck run against the Brindlewood sample corpus before it ships — no exceptions, even for hotfixes. The validator itself lives in the ops enclave, and its config bundle is encrypted at rest. Jonas from platform usually handles rotation, but during releases you'll need to unlock it yourself. To decrypt the bundle, enter the recovery passphrase below.

unlock words, kajeg-fahif: holmir-casael-novdor